Bodyslam.net’s Cassidy Haynes reported that AEW officials are currently planning to leave Daily’s Place in Jacksonville, where they’ve been running shows for the past several months, for a new venue in Miami next month.
Haynes reported that the reason for the upcoming move is due to some complaints from AEW wrestlers about having to wrestle in cold outdoor weather and wanting to wrestle in a warmer location. Haynes also reported that AEW officials currently feel that a change in scenery would help improve everyone’s morale and issues with outdoor winter wrestling.
It was also reported that AEW is currently planning on staying in Miami for at least one month and likely will return to Jacksonville by March.
